About the role

Responsibilities

  • Lead the design and development of specialized load-handling equipment through the entire R&D lifecycle
  • Develop early-stage CAD models, calculations, and cost estimates during the concept phase
  • Perform finite element analysis (FEA), stress analysis, and load simulations to validate designs
  • Collaborate with the Fabrication Services Department to ensure adherence to design specifications and quality standards
  • Oversee load testing of specialty rigging tools to verify safety and functionality
  • Serve as a field technical liaison for critical lifts, providing risk management and safety evaluations
  • Manage multiple R&D projects simultaneously, including budgets, schedules, and risks
  • Mentor junior engineers and review technical documentation such as fabrication drawings and FEA reports
  • Research and implement emerging technologies and materials to improve equipment performance

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Mechanical Engineering, Civil Engineering, or a related field from an ABET accredited university
  • 7+ years of experience designing mechanical or structural equipment for heavy lift or transport industries
  • Proficiency in CAD software such as SolidWorks, AutoCAD, or Inventor
  • Expertise in structural analysis, FEA, and stress/fatigue analysis
  • Knowledge of cranes, hoists, hydraulic systems, winches, and rigging equipment
  • Familiarity with engineering software like RISA-3D, Ansys, Mathcad, or MS Excel
  • Understanding of industry standards including OSHA, AISC, AWS, ASME B30, and ANSI
  • Ability to travel to project sites and work in outdoor or construction environments

About the Company

Barnhart specializes in the lifting, heavy-rigging, and heavy transport of major components used in American industry. With over 60 branch locations across the U.S., Barnhart is known for solving complex engineering problems through innovation and a "One TEAM" culture.
